| +namespace mojo {
|
| +
|
| +// Stub clipboard implementation.
|
| +//
|
| +// Eventually, we'll actually want to interact with the system clipboard, but
|
| +// that's hard today because the system clipboard is asynchronous (on X11), the
|
| +// ui::Clipboard interface is synchronous (which is what we'd use), mojo is
|
| +// asynchronous across processes, and the WebClipboard interface is synchronous
|
| +// (which is at least tractable).
|
| +class ClipboardStandaloneImpl : public InterfaceImpl<mojo::Clipboard> {
|
| + public:
|
| + // mojo::Clipboard exposes three possible clipboards.
|
| + static const int kNumClipboards = 3;
|
| +
|
| + ClipboardStandaloneImpl();
|
| + virtual ~ClipboardStandaloneImpl();
|
| +
|
| + // InterfaceImpl<mojo::Clipboard> implementation.
|
| + virtual void GetSequenceNumber(Clipboard::Type clipboard_type,
|
| + const mojo::Callback<void(uint64_t)>& callback)
|
| + MOJO_OVERRIDE;
|
| + virtual void GetAvailableMimeTypes(
|
| + Clipboard::Type clipboard_types,
|
| + const mojo::Callback<void(mojo::Array<mojo::String>)>& callback)
|
| + MOJO_OVERRIDE;
|
| + virtual void ReadMimeType(
|
| + Clipboard::Type clipboard_type,
|
| + const mojo::String& mime_type,
|
| + const mojo::Callback<void(mojo::Array<uint8_t>)>& callback)
|
| + MOJO_OVERRIDE;
|
| + virtual void WriteClipboardData(Clipboard::Type clipboard_type,
|
| + mojo::Array<MimeTypePairPtr> data)
|
| + MOJO_OVERRIDE;
|
| +
|
| + private:
|
| + uint64_t sequence_number_[kNumClipboards];
|
| +
|
| + // Internal struct which stores the current state of the clipboard.
|
| + class ClipboardData;
|
| +
|
| + // The current clipboard state. This is what is read from.
|
| + scoped_ptr<ClipboardData> clipboard_state_[kNumClipboards];
|
| +
|
| + DISALLOW_COPY_AND_ASSIGN(ClipboardStandaloneImpl);
|
| +};
|
| +
|
| +} // namespace mojo
